    Completed today but not without some last minute stress from Bluestone. Day before completion they decided my signature on my DD mandate didn't match my signature on my application 🙈 so had to sign a other form which was a nightmare to get the same as none of my signatures are ever the same. 
    They also queried why I has sick on my March payslip. Explained I had Covid, Bluestone still not happy and wanted my store manager to reply to an email confirming why I was off. 

    Finally a day later than planned Bluestone released the funds. Best advice I can give is submit bank statements and payslips at the start of every month. We submitted our mortgage application on the 4th December.
